Abstract

A perineal wound is a condition where tissue continuity is broken which occurs in almost all first deliveries and not infrequently also occurs in subsequent deliveries. If this situation is not handled properly, bleeding infection can occur which can result in high maternal morbidity and mortality. The aim of the research is to carry out Midwifery Care for the Postpartum Period with Level II Perineal Rupture using a midwifery management approach in accordance with the midwife's authority. The research method used is the case study writing method, namely carrying out case studies using a midwifery management approach. Results of a study on the implementation and implementation of midwifery care for clients with Grade II Perineal Rupture Pain at the Palangga Community Health Center, Gowa Regency. In the theoretical application of midwifery care, starting from data analysis, formulating actual and potential future diagnoses. Immediate action or collaboration, planning, management and evaluation of midwifery care that occurs.
